Transaction 9dc76e20d4c71197617ac08bf93626965eaee41c984be7d7f5c82d633cbc3383

78 Input
2 Outputs
  • 9dc76e20d4c71197617ac08bf93626965eaee41c984be7d7f5c82d633cbc3383:0
  • value  505899193
    address  18624Vh5vM9BpsJnsB2Q8xZJzrhDuKJ8DL
  • 9dc76e20d4c71197617ac08bf93626965eaee41c984be7d7f5c82d633cbc3383:1
  • value  1000087
    address  16iZGsrgScXmrsBcECgDU7BSf2e9VhFpm3